What's so impressive about these charms is that I could never find a ‘right’ answer when equipping them. The stronger the effect they have, the more notches they take. They can do simple things such as increase the amount of Soul you get from hitting enemies or improve your attack range, as well as apply more complex modifications such as doubling your health but preventing you from healing or giving you a ranged attack while at full health. Charms imbue the player with special abilities, but you only have a limited number of 'notches' in which to equip them. Charmingĭiscovering and customizing my character with charms gave me thoughtful decisions to make throughout my entire 35-hour playthrough. SMCL (Stata Markup and Control Language pronounced as "smickle") is used to modify all text output in Stata. Greek letters, math symbols, and other symbols (such as Copyright and Trademark symbols) can be incorporated in Stata graphs with the use of SMCL tags. If this were not specified, as in the plot for y = x^2, the plot will be connected by 300 (the default) markers - ugly. What is "n(#)" for? This tells Stata to draw the plot at 20 points. In our case, we specified that the new plot type is a connected graph, for which you can specify marker symbols. The recast option will tell Stata to treat the plot as a new plot. Tw function y = x^2, range(-2 2) recast(connected) msymbol(O) || ///įunction y = x^3, range(-2 2) recast(connected) msymbol(T) n(20) || ///įunction y = x^4, range(-2 2) recast(connected) msymbol(S) n(20) /// For example:įunction y = x^3, range(-2 2) lpattern(-) || ///įunction y = x^4, range(-2 2) lpattern(.-) ///Ĭols(3) pos(5) ring(0) region(lcolor(none)))īut suppose you prefer to use marker symbols rather than line patterns to differentiate the line plots, how can you specify this option? Use the recast option (-help advanced_options-): These options are particularly helpful when you have many functions to plot. Tw function y = 4*x^2, range(-2 2) lcolor(red) lwidth(medthick) lpattern(-) For example, if you want to change the color, width, and pattern of the line use lcolor, lwidth, and lpattern options: It is easy to change the line attributes of the plot. ![]() If you want to draw the other side of the parabola or change the range, you can specify the range as follows: The default is that the function is drawn over the range. For example, the half of a parabola with the equation y = x^2 can be drawn by typing: Stata's -graph twoway function- draws the line plot of a specified function. ![]() ![]() GET YOURS TODAY: Valorant US$10 Gift Card Here’s a look at different Valorant pro players’ crosshair codes that you can copy and use in your next match.
